3478B was an inspector's van often to be found parked in Victoria Bus Station and hence was one of the most frequently photographed service vehicles, despite only being in stock for about 15 months. Acquired on lease from Avis in November 1986, it was reportedly withdrawn in February 1988 while the majority of the same batch lasted until 1989 or 1990. I liked this photo (taken on 12th April 1987) because it also includes a Green Line TDL coach, a very unusual sight in the bus station.
